Ticket: Pool-config vault locked on the Harrowgate database tier. New folks: the vault stores connection-pool settings (max connections, idle timeouts) for the Finchly cluster, and it auto-locks after three failed reads. Until it's unlocked, pools fall back to defaults, which caused last night's saturation. To unlock, run vaultctl open on the Finchly bastion and enter the recovery passphrase below.

unlock words, hahip-baduf: holwyn-istath-julvan

**Ticket #—: Missed pick-up, Greywick Museum labels**

Morning run skipped the label collection at Pellman Print for the new Tidewater Gallery opening. Labels are mounted and boxed, waiting at their front counter. Gallery install starts Wednesday — no slack left. Shift lead: slot this into tomorrow's first run, flag as priority, confirm box count on collection. Driver executes the hand-over per the confidential line below.

handover note for yagef-bagep: the drudor pelius courier leaves the kasdor zorvan norir ledger at gate 8016 under passcode 755406

Quick notes for the eng sync on Stringsift, our translation-string extraction script. It crawls the Bramblewood repos nightly, pulls any new marked strings, and dumps them into the locale staging store for the translators. If extraction counts look weird, check the parser version first — that's been the culprit twice now. The script writes everything to the staging database using the connection string below.

primary connection of tawif-yajeg = postgresql://rusiel_svc:G879q9cx6GsSvj@db-dd9f.norvagrid.internal:5432/casath

## Crash Reports: Quick Start

Crash dumps from the Lumawell mobile app flow through the Siftrail pipeline: device upload, symbolication, then grouping into issues. New members get read access by default. To run the symbolicator locally against staging, you need the pipeline's internal service credential. It rotates quarterly; the current key is provided below.

API key for yahig-tadup: kto7_ubizbYm